青少年学习编程可以从以下几个方面入手:
学习编程基础知识
了解编程语言的基本语法和概念。
学习常用数据结构和算法。
掌握基本的编程技巧。
参加编程课程或培训班
通过系统的课程学习,有老师指导和同学互动,可以更快地掌握编程技能。
解决编程问题
尝试编写一些简单的程序,如计算器或打印九九乘法表,通过实践提高编程能力。
参加编程比赛
通过比赛锻炼编程能力,了解其他人的编程思路,并与其他编程爱好者交流。
参与开源项目
加入开源项目团队,向有经验的开发者学习,学习协作开发,提高编程能力。
开发个人项目
尝试开发个人项目,如个人网站或简单的手机应用程序,通过实际项目开发应用编程知识。
加入编程社区
参与技术论坛、编程社交媒体等,与其他编程爱好者交流、分享和学习。
阅读编程书籍和教程
阅读优秀的编程书籍和教程,系统学习编程知识和经验。
学习开发工具和框架
掌握常用的开发工具和框架,如编程编辑器、集成开发环境和开发框架,提高开发效率和代码质量。
应用编程知识解决实际问题
将所学编程知识应用于实际问题,例如开发帮助学习的应用程序或环保智能设备。
建议
选择合适的编程语言:根据孩子的兴趣和基础选择适合的编程语言,如Python、Scratch等。
提供良好的学习环境:确保孩子有安静、舒适的学习环境,并有足够的时间学习编程。
鼓励孩子参与编程社区:让孩子参与编程论坛、比赛等,结识更多编程爱好者,互相学习和交流。
多练习:编程学习需要大量练习,让孩子不断巩固所学知识,提高编程技能。
多读书:保持阅读编程书籍的习惯,学习新的编程知识和技巧。
通过以上方法,青少年可以逐步掌握编程技能,并在实践中不断提高。